Silent Turnover Shrinkage

Equipment moves during make-ready turns or functional components get swapped without records. Without a physical chain of custody, the loss is quietly absorbed as operating friction.

02

Uncaptured Warranty Coverage

Technicians replace failed components on active equipment with zero awareness that the part is covered under manufacturer warranty. Portfolios pay out of pocket for repairs that are already guaranteed.

03

Blind Capital Allocation

Asset managers discover aging equipment clusters only when failures cause emergency tenant disruption. CapEx is forced into reactive crisis management instead of planned lifecycle replacement.

The infrastructure layer for $240B in residential appliance assets.

Across 22M+ professionally managed multifamily units, operators oversee more than 140M in-unit appliance assets ($10k–$14k of equipment per door) — losing billions annually to unrecorded turnover swaps, unclaimed OEM warranties ($380–$1,200 each), and missing service histories. Nameplate gives every appliance an immutable ground truth.

The record gets harder to replace over time

Every turn, inspection, and repair writes a signed entry against a physical tag. A year in, an operator has a service history no competitor can reconstruct — because the work already happened.

02
It pays back in the first year

Operators stop replacing appliances they still own, file OEM warranty claims worth $380–$1,200 each instead of missing them, and cut turn inspections from 45 minutes to under three.

03
It works where there is no signal

Utility rooms and basements have no coverage. The field app records everything on the device and reconciles in order once it reconnects — nothing dropped, nothing double-counted.
